    I just bought a calico for $175. Spiders are pretty cheap as well. Cinnamons are very pretty, but I really like the dark snakes. I have a king pin which is a lesser pinstripe and he is very pretty. Cost me $200. The reptile expos are the best place to get the best deals. Another time to wait is when breeding season is over. At that time a lot of breeders have some left overs and are selling them cheap to get them off their hands to make space for the new season. I bought a fire woma for $100 from a breeder in November.
